CSS inset-block-start Property
The inset-block-start property is used to define logical block start offset, not for the inline offset or logical block. This property can apply to any writing-mode property.
Syntax
inset-block-start: length|percentage|auto|inherit|initial|unset;
Property Values
Values |
Descriptions |
---|---|
length |
It sets a fixed value defined in px, cm, pt, etc. Negative values are allowed. Its default value is 0px. |
percentage(%) |
It is the same as length but the size is set in terms of percentage of the window size. |
auto |
It is used when it is desired that the browser determines the block-size. |
initial |
It is used to set the value of the inset-block-start property to its default value. |
inherit |
It is used when it is desired that the element inherits the inset-block-start property of its parent as its own. |
unset |
It is used unset the default inset-block-start. |

Supported Browsers
The browsers supported by inset-block-start property are listed below:
- Firefox 63
- Google Chrome 87
- Edge 87
- Opera 73
- Safari 14.1
